isotretinoin (oral)(eye so TREH tih noyn)

What is the most important information I should know about Accutane?
• Accutane is a medication taken to treat severe nodular acne that hasnot been helped by other treatments, including antibiotics accutane. However, Accutanecan cause serious side effects accutane. Before starting treatment with Accutane, discusswith your doctor how bad the acne is, the possible benefits of Accutane, andthe possible side effects accutane. Your doctor will ask you to read and sign a formindicating that you understand the serious risks associated with Accutane therapy accutane.
• Do not take Accutane if you are pregnant or if you could become pregnantduring treatment or for one month after you stop taking Accutane accutane. Accutane isin the FDA pregnancy category X accutane. This means that Accutane is known to causesevere birth defects in an unborn baby accutane. It can also cause miscarriage, prematurebirth, or death of the baby accutane. You must take a pregnancy test and have negativeresults when you and your doctor decide that Accutane may be beneficial foryour condition accutane. You must have a second pregnancy test with negative resultsduring the first 5 days of the menstrual period right before you start takingAccutane accutane. Two reliable forms of birth control must be used at the same time(unless abstinence is the chosen method of birth control or if you have undergonea hysterectomy) for one month before starting treatment with Accutane, duringtreatment with Accutane, and for at least 1 month following the end of treatment accutane. You will also be asked to take a pregnancy test on a monthly basis accutane. Your doctorwill discuss with you and provide for you a video and written information regardingchoices for birth control, possible causes for birth control failure, and theimportance of using birth control while taking Accutane accutane. If you become pregnant,stop using birth control, or miss your menstrual period, immediately stop takingAccutane and notify your doctor accutane.
• Some patients have experienced depression (including feelings of sadness,irritability, unusual tiredness, trouble concentrating, and loss of appetite)and suicidal thoughts and/or behavior during, and soon after stopping, treatmentwith Accutane accutane. Notify your doctor immediately if you begin to experience signsof depression or if you begin to have thoughts about taking your own life duringor shortly following treatment with Accutane accutane.
• Do not take vitamin supplements containing vitamin A during treatmentwith Accutane accutane. This could cause increased side effects accutane.
• Do not donate blood while taking Accutane and for at least 1 month followingthe end of treatment accutane. Blood donated while taking Accutane may be given to apregnant woman and be harmful to her baby accutane.
• Do not use wax hair removal systems or have any skin resurfacing procedures(such as dermabrasion or laser treatment) performed while taking Accutane andfor six months following treatment due to the possibility of scarring accutane.
• Avoid exposure to sunlight or UV rays while taking Accutane accutane. Accutanemay increase the sensitivity of the skin to sunlight and a severe sunburn couldresult accutane.
• Use caution when driving a vehicle at night accutane. Accutane can cause decreasednight vision accutane. The onset of decreased night vision may be sudden accutane.
• Take all of the Accutane that has been prescribed for you even if yoursymptoms start to improve accutane. The acne may seem to get worse at the start of therapy,but should then begin to improve accutane. For the best results, finish all of the medicationthat has been prescribed accutane. You may require more than one course of therapy withAccutane accutane.


What is Accutane?
• Accutane is a form of vitamin A accutane. It decreases the amount of sebum (oil)that is released by the sebaceous (oil) glands, and it increases that rate atwhich the skin renews itself accutane.
• Accutane is used to treat severe nodular acne that has not respondedto other treatments, including antibiotics accutane.
• Accutane may also be used for purposes other than those listed in thismedication guide accutane.


What should I discuss with my healthcare provider before taking Accutane?
• Before taking Accutane, tell your doctor if you have
· a personal or family history of mental problems including depression,suicidal behavior, or psychosis (loss of contact with reality, hearing voices,or seeing things that are not there);
· diabetes;
· asthma;
· heart disease;
· osteoporosis (bone loss) or weak bones;
· anorexia nervosa;
· high cholesterol or triglyceride levels (types of fat) in the blood;or
· liver disease accutane.
• You may not be able to take Accutane, or you may require a dosage adjustmentor special monitoring during treatment if you have any of the conditions listedabove accutane.

• It is not known whether Accutane passes into breast milk accutane. Do not takeAccutane without first talking to your doctor if you are breast-feeding a baby accutane.


How should I take Accutane?
• Take Accutane exactly as directed by your doctor accutane. If you do not understandthese instructions, ask your pharmacist, nurse, or doctor to explain them toyou accutane.

• You will get no more than a 30-day supply of Accutane at a time accutane. Yourprescription should have a special yellow self-adhesive sticker attached toit accutane. If your prescription does not have this yellow sticker, call your doctor accutane. The pharmacy should not fill the prescription without this sticker accutane.
• Take each dose of Accutane with a full glass of water accutane. This will helpprevent the medication inside the capsule from irritating the lining of theesophagus accutane. For the same reason, do not chew or suck on the capsule accutane.
• Take Accutane twice a day with food or milk to get the best results fromthis medication, unless otherwise directed by your doctor accutane.

• Your doctor may perform blood tests during treatment with Accutane tomonitor side effects from this medication accutane.
• Due to the serious side effects that may occur with the use of this medication,do not share it with anyone else accutane.
• Store Accutane at room temperature away from moisture and heat accutane.


What happens if I miss a dose?
• Take the missed dose as soon as you remember accutane. However, if it is almosttime for the next dose, skip the missed dose and only take the next regularlyscheduled dose accutane. Do not take a double dose of this medication accutane.


What happens if I overdose?
• Seek emergency medical attention accutane.
• Symptoms of an Accutane overdose include vomiting, abdominal pain, flushingof the face, inflammation of the lips, headache, dizziness, and clumsiness accutane.


What should I avoid while taking Accutane?
• Do not take vitamin supplements containing vitamin A during treatmentwith Accutane accutane. This could cause increased side effects accutane.
• Do not donate blood while taking Accutane and for at least 1 month followingthe end of treatment accutane. Blood donated while taking Accutane may be given to apregnant woman and be harmful to her baby accutane.
• Do not use wax hair removal systems or have any skin resurfacing procedures(such as dermabrasion or laser treatment) performed while taking Accutane andfor six months following treatment due to the possibility of scarring accutane.
• Avoid exposure to sunlight or UV rays while taking Accutane accutane. Accutanemay increase the sensitivity of the skin to sunlight and a severe sunburn couldresult accutane.
• Use caution when driving a vehicle at night accutane. Accutane can cause decreasednight vision accutane. The onset of decreased night vision may be sudden accutane.


What are the possible side effects of Accutane?
• Stop taking Accutane and seek emergency medical attention or contactyour doctor immediately if you experience any of the following serious sideeffects:
· an allergic reaction (difficulty breathing; closing of the throat;swelling of the lips, tongue, or face; or hives);
· changes in vision, blurred vision, or decreased vision (especiallyat night);
· painful or constant dryness of the eyes;
· depression including feelings of sadness, crying spells, irritability,changes in sleep patterns, unusual tiredness, trouble concentrating, loss ofappetite, and/or suicidal thoughts or other mental problems;
· stomach, chest, or bowel pain;
· rectal bleeding, or severe or bloody diarrhea;
· difficulty or pain when swallowing;
· new or worsening heartburn;
· yellowing of the skin or eyes or persistently dark urine;
· severe headache or dizziness;
· seizures;
· nausea and vomiting;
· joint or muscle pain or bone problems;
· hearing problems or hearing loss;
· trouble breathing;
· fainting;
· increased thirst or urination;
· slurred speech or problems moving;
· leg swelling;
· increased levels of cholesterol or triglyceride (types of fat) in yourblood (detected by blood tests) accutane.
• Other, less serious side effects are more likely to occur accutane. Continue totake Accutane and talk to your doctor if you experience
· inflammation, dryness, or cracking of the lips;
· dry skin, dry mouth, dry or bleeding nose, dryness of the eyes and/ordifficulty wearing contact lenses;
· itching; or
· increased sensitivity of the skin to the sun accutane.
• Side effects other than those listed here may also occur accutane. Talk to yourdoctor about any side effect that seems unusual or that is especially bothersome accutane.


What other drugs will affect Accutane?
• Do not take any of the following medicines while taking Accutane:
· vitamin supplements containing vitamin A; or
· a tetracycline antibiotic such as tetracycline (Sumycin, Achromycin,Panmycin, Robitet, others), minocycline (Minocin, Dynacin, Vectrin), doxycycline(Doryx, Monodox, Vibramycin, Vibra-Tabs), demeclocycline (Declomycin), or troleandomycin(TAO) accutane.
• Taking any of the drugs listed above during treatment with Accutane maybe dangerous accutane.
• Before taking Accutane, tell your doctor if you are taking carbamazepine(Tegretol, Carbatrol, Epitol) accutane. You may require a dosage adjustment or specialmonitoring during treatment accutane.
• Do not use other acne medications unless otherwise directed by your doctor accutane. They may interfere with the treatment or increase irritation of the skin accutane.
• Do not take birth control pills that do not contain estrogen ("minipills")during treatment with Accutane accutane. They may not work while taking Accutane accutane.
• Drugs other than those listed here may also interact with Accutane accutane. Talkto your doctor or pharmacist before taking any prescription or over-the-countermedicines, including herbal products accutane.
